I work at an oil refinery as a process operator. We plan maintenance including safety safeguards for all kinds of interventions and for that we discuss what is needed with the guys from maintenance, trying to get things done as safe as possible with minimal impact on production.

The one area where we don't make any safety input is electric. Whatever they say they need, we do it their way. If they say we need to shutdown, we shutdown. If we can't, the maintenance is postponed to the planned general maintenance shutdown.

It's a Newtonian Greika 1400150.

The original was plastic and broke when moving houses, the 3D printed lasted for a while, but it looks like the filament didn't hold together under tension.

The tripod is for a basic equatorial mount, I could replace it, but am trying to find what looks like a cheap part. Worst case, I am using it with the legs tied together where this piece would go.
